About

Danial Borooghani is a researcher focused on assistive robotics and rehabilitation engineering, with a particular emphasis on lower limb exoskeletons designed to improve mobility for individuals with disabilities. His most notable contribution is the development of a novel lower limb exoskeleton specifically engineered to assist users in stair ascending—a challenging and high-demand activity for many with mobility impairments. In his highly cited 2019 work, Borooghani introduced an innovative design that integrates motors and cables, creating a lightweight, wearable system that prioritizes ease of use and practical application. This approach addresses critical gaps in exoskeleton technology by balancing mechanical support with user comfort, making assistive devices more accessible for daily living.
